Gradual changes in the chemical composition of spinel cause variations in the distribution of cations in sites, which affects their properties and colouration. Thus, pigments with nickel-zinc spinel structures (NixZn1-xAl2O4) were synthesized by combustion and characterized by varying the chromophore ion content (x = 0; 0.1; 0.2; 0.4 and 1) and calcination temperature (600 degrees, 800 degrees and 1000 degrees C). Characterization of aluminates through thermal analysis (TGA) showed a less than 10% mass loss until approximately 500 degrees C in not-calcined samples, indicating the combustion reaction could be classified as adequate. The spinel phase was confirmed in all samples by X-ray diffraction (XRD) with segregated phases: ZnO in samples with x = 0 and NiO in samples with x = 0.4 and 1. The post-synthesis thermal treatment at high temperature led to higher crystallinity of the material and the incorporation of secondary phases into the spinel structure. The crystallite size varied between 22.9 and 43.2 nm. Scanning Electron Microscopy (SEM) analysis indicated that the pore size increased with the increasing calcination temperature, and infrared spectroscopy indicated the displacement of the A106 band (665 cm(-1)) to A104 (730 cm(-1)) after the addition of Ni2+ ions, revealing the inversion of the crystalline structure. Colorimetric analysis by the CIELab method showed the colour of the zinc-nickel pigments ranged between white (x = 0) and cyan tones (0 < x <= 1). Furthermore, the significant influence of the chromophore ion content and calcination temperature on the colouration of the synthesized pigments was verified by the Tukey test at 5% in terms of the luminosity (L*) and chromaticity (a* and b*). The difference between dry powder and that dispersed in varnish was considered evident. The colorimetric data were used to develop a mathematical model to satisfactorily describe the values of L*, a* and b* as functions of the calcination temperature and nickel load.
